Summary
In Leadership by Design, Vicere and Fulmer argue that executive development is undergoing a fundamental shift away from conventional methods that benefit only a few chosen successors toward a strategy that drives the flexibility, commitment, and competitiveness of the entire organization. With Leadership by Design, they explain strategic leadership development: what it is, how it evolves, and how it is being addressed through both traditional techniques as well as revolutionary new practices. Here, in a single volume, Vicere and Fulmer have synthesized the most influential ideas that shape the current thinking on organizational strategies for professional growth and executive education.
